Transaction 8bcbe107dbda2e8fe398813e7255f14ce911adf06e0c6c51157cdc7a88920182

1 Input
2 Outputs
  • 8bcbe107dbda2e8fe398813e7255f14ce911adf06e0c6c51157cdc7a88920182:0
  • value  1763376
    address  1NLd7Ghhs3bSc2kjhbXa2vGRZ9EFovKVVZ
  • 8bcbe107dbda2e8fe398813e7255f14ce911adf06e0c6c51157cdc7a88920182:1
  • value  20006183
    address  3Nv5J6QPgp8mJ7MhBKmLZasjR3MPnU8LcQ